You may have seen a scare campaign pushed by the AMA and the usual suspects out there about the Medicare rebate being reduced by $20. The letter doing the rounds is missing a few facts. Here they are: 1) The $20 rebate change applies to consultations less than 10 minutes only. 2) Pensioners, children under 16 and the 8 million concession holders are exempt. 3) All other consultations are NOT affected. - Government statistics show that only 26% of consultations are under 10 mins. It is up to the doctors if they want to pass this onto you or continue to bulk bill. The government claims it wants to put an end to the 6 minute in out supermarket consult and wants doctors to spend more time with their patients. It argues the unfairness of a doctor receiving the same rebate for a 6 minute consult as it does for a 19 minute consult. You can see why the doctors are up in arms. They will either have to spend more time with a patient to claim the current rebate, and therefore perhaps see less patients in the hour; or wear the cost; or refuse to bulk bill in which case the patient may look elsewhere for one who does.
